Chairman Ramlal hands over the CEC to Mr. George Vieira – Managing Director – EOG Resources.

The EMA has granted approval to EOG Resources to explore two offshore gas wells off Trinidad’s North Coast.

The Certificate of Environmental Clearance covers wells TG-1 and TG-2 and is the first issued by the EMA’s new board for the oil and gas sector.

EMA chairman Doolar Ramlal said the approval was completed within the required timeframe, following a full technical review, and confirmed that an environmental impact assessment was not required.
